Title says it all. Doesn’t happen every time I wake the computer up but it’s happened three or four times in the last month or so?
Arch: x86_64
Version: 6.16.8-arch3-1
[167112.620587] usb 1-11: WARN: invalid context state for evaluate context command.
[167112.624450] ------------[ cut here ]------------
[167112.624451] kernel BUG at mm/vmalloc.c:3167!
[167112.624458] Oops: invalid opcode: 0000 [#1] SMP NOPTI
[167112.624460] CPU: 4 UID: 0 PID: 564138 Comm: kworker/u32:38 Not tainted 6.16.8-arch3-1 #1 PREEMPT(full) c3805c1210d56bc7a68d560dd9e968bb1cc9c38e
[167112.624462] Hardware name: Micro-Star International Co., Ltd. MS-7E47/PRO X870-P WIFI (MS-7E47), BIOS 1.A31 01/21/2025
[167112.624463] Workqueue: async async_run_entry_fn
[167112.624467] RIP: 0010:__get_vm_area_node+0x12d/0x130
[167112.624470] Code: 83 c1 01 39 d1 0f 4c ca ba 1e 00 00 00 39 d1 0f 4f ca 48 d3 e6 49 89 f7 e9 35 ff ff ff 4c 89 f7 e8 a8 05 02 00 45 31 f6 eb ae <0f> 0b 90 90 90 90 90 90 90 90 90 90 90 90 90 90 90 90 90 66 0f 1f
[167112.624471] RSP: 0018:ffffd37b086ef360 EFLAGS: 00010202
[167112.624472] RAX: 0000000000000dc0 RBX: 0000000000001000 RCX: 0000000000000422
[167112.624473] RDX: 000000000000000c RSI: 0000000000001000 RDI: 0000000000038ba0
[167112.624474] RBP: 000000000000000c R08: ffffd37b00000000 R09: fffff37affffffff
[167112.624474] R10: 8000000000000163 R11: 0000000000000000 R12: 8000000000000163
[167112.624474] R13: 000000000000000c R14: 00000000ffffffff R15: 0000000000000dc0
[167112.624475] FS: 0000000000000000(0000) GS:ffff8ca5e501a000(0000) knlGS:0000000000000000
[167112.624476] C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033
[167112.624476] CR2: 0000000000000000 CR3: 00000002f1024000 CR4: 0000000000f50ef0
[167112.624477] PKRU: 55555554
[167112.624477] Call Trace:
[167112.624478] <TASK>
[167112.624478] __vmalloc_node_range_noprof+0x139/0x8e0
[167112.624483] ? dc_create_plane_state+0x23/0x80 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.624629] ? __alloc_frozen_pages_noprof+0x334/0x350
[167112.624631] ? dc_create_plane_state+0x23/0x80 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.624735] __kvmalloc_node_noprof+0x2f3/0x640
[167112.624738] ? dc_create_plane_state+0x23/0x80 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.624831] ? dc_create_plane_state+0x23/0x80 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.624923] ? dcn20_build_pipe_pix_clk_params+0x1d/0x40 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.625048] ? dc_create_plane_state+0x23/0x80 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.625141] dc_create_plane_state+0x23/0x80 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.625233] dc_state_create_phantom_plane+0x1a/0x60 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.625327] dcn32_add_phantom_pipes+0x163/0x440 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.625439] dcn32_internal_validate_bw+0xbc7/0x1610 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.625575] ? dml1_validate+0x67/0x2c0 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.625684] dml1_validate+0xc0/0x2c0 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.625787] dcn32_validate_bandwidth+0xb7/0x1c0 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.625887] update_planes_and_stream_state+0x399/0x500 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.625992] update_planes_and_stream_v2+0x22b/0x560 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.626091] dc_update_planes_and_stream+0x71/0xf0 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.626186] ? sort+0x34/0x60
[167112.626189] amdgpu_dm_atomic_commit_tail+0x1591/0x3840 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.626317] commit_tail+0x9e/0x130
[167112.626319] drm_atomic_helper_commit+0x13c/0x180
[167112.626321] drm_atomic_commit+0xae/0xe0
[167112.626322] ? __pfx___drm_printfn_info+0x10/0x10
[167112.626324] drm_atomic_helper_commit_duplicated_state+0xde/0xf0
[167112.626326] drm_atomic_helper_resume+0xa1/0x170
[167112.626327] dm_resume+0x3a1/0x7b0 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.626443] amdgpu_ip_block_resume+0x24/0x50 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.626519] amdgpu_device_ip_resume_phase3+0x5d/0x80 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.626594] amdgpu_device_resume+0xae/0x310 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.626671] amdgpu_pmops_resume+0x46/0x80 [amdgpu 92b91698f5fdc75bb5edcf1fccc3b23ea333fc47]
[167112.626747] ? __pfx_pci_pm_resume+0x10/0x10
[167112.626749] dpm_run_callback+0x47/0x150
[167112.626751] device_resume+0x183/0x280
[167112.626752] async_resume+0x21/0x30
[167112.626753] async_run_entry_fn+0x33/0x140
[167112.626753] process_one_work+0x190/0x350
[167112.626755] worker_thread+0x2d7/0x410
[167112.626756] ? __pfx_worker_thread+0x10/0x10
[167112.626758] kthread+0xf9/0x240
[167112.626759] ? __pfx_kthread+0x10/0x10
[167112.626759] ? __pfx_kthread+0x10/0x10
[167112.626760] ret_from_fork+0x1c1/0x1f0
[167112.626762] ? __pfx_kthread+0x10/0x10
[167112.626762] ret_from_fork_asm+0x1a/0x30
[167112.626764] </TASK>
[167112.626765] Modules linked in: udp_diag tcp_diag inet_diag wireguard curve25519_x86_64 libcurve25519_generic ip6_udp_tunnel udp_tunnel nft_masq nft_fib_inet nft_fib_ipv4 nft_fib_ipv6 nft_fib nft_ct vfat fat amdgpu amd_atl intel_rapl_msr intel_rapl_common snd_hda_codec_realtek uvcvideo snd_hda_codec_generic amdxcp snd_hda_scodec_component videobuf2_vmalloc gpu_sched snd_hda_codec_hdmi uvc drm_panel_backlight_quirks videobuf2_memops snd_hda_intel kvm_amd snd_intel_dspcfg videobuf2_v4l2 snd_intel_sdw_acpi spd5118 snd_usb_audio videobuf2_common btusb drm_buddy kvm videodev snd_hda_codec drm_exec btrtl snd_usbmidi_lib drm_suballoc_helper drm_ttm_helper btintel snd_ump irqbypass ttm btbcm snd_hda_core i2c_piix4 btmtk snd_rawmidi i2c_algo_bit wmi_bmof rapl pcspkr k10temp i2c_smbus snd_hwdep snd_seq_device bluetooth snd_pcm drm_display_helper snd_timer r8169 rfkill snd cec realtek mc soundcore mdio_devres libphy mdio_bus gpio_amdpt amd_3d_vcache gpio_generic acpi_pad joydev mousedev mac_hid nft_reject_inet nf_reject_ipv4
[167112.626787] nf_reject_ipv6 nft_reject nft_chain_nat nf_nat nf_conntrack nf_defrag_ipv6 nf_defrag_ipv4 nf_tables loop nfnetlink ip_tables x_tables dm_crypt encrypted_keys trusted asn1_encoder tee polyval_clmulni ghash_clmulni_intel sha512_ssse3 sha1_ssse3 aesni_intel thunderbolt sp5100_tco nvme ccp nvme_core nvme_keyring nvme_auth video wmi dm_mirror dm_region_hash dm_log dm_mod pkcs8_key_parser i2c_dev crypto_user
[167112.626799] ---[ end trace 0000000000000000 ]---
[167112.626800] RIP: 0010:__get_vm_area_node+0x12d/0x130
[167112.626801] Code: 83 c1 01 39 d1 0f 4c ca ba 1e 00 00 00 39 d1 0f 4f ca 48 d3 e6 49 89 f7 e9 35 ff ff ff 4c 89 f7 e8 a8 05 02 00 45 31 f6 eb ae <0f> 0b 90 90 90 90 90 90 90 90 90 90 90 90 90 90 90 90 90 66 0f 1f
[167112.626802] RSP: 0018:ffffd37b086ef360 EFLAGS: 00010202
[167112.626802] RAX: 0000000000000dc0 RBX: 0000000000001000 RCX: 0000000000000422
[167112.626803] RDX: 000000000000000c RSI: 0000000000001000 RDI: 0000000000038ba0
[167112.626803] RBP: 000000000000000c R08: ffffd37b00000000 R09: fffff37affffffff
[167112.626803] R10: 8000000000000163 R11: 0000000000000000 R12: 8000000000000163
[167112.626804] R13: 000000000000000c R14: 00000000ffffffff R15: 0000000000000dc0
[167112.626804] FS: 0000000000000000(0000) GS:ffff8ca5e501a000(0000) knlGS:0000000000000000
[167112.626805] C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033
[167112.626805] CR2: 0000000000000000 CR3: 00000002f1024000 CR4: 0000000000f50ef0
[167112.626805] PKRU: 55555554
[167112.626806] Kernel panic - not syncing: Fatal exception in interrupt
[167112.627027] Kernel Offset: 0x35600000 from 0xffffffff81000000 (relocation range: 0xffffffff80000000-0xffffffffbfffffff)
[167112.627031] amdgpu 0000:0e:00.0: amdgpu: [drm] amdgpu panic, pixel format is not 32bits
My GPU is an RX 7800 XT for reference.